ORSYS formation
CONTACT - +352 26 49 79 1204
CONTACT - 📞 +352 26 49 79 1204    drapeau francais   drapeau anglais

Consult our trainings :

PostgreSQL, administration avancée Training

Stage pratique
Duration : 3 days
Ref : PAA
Price  2020 : Contact us
  • Program
  • Participants / Prerequisite
  • Intra/Tailored
Program

A la fin de ce cours, vous connaîtrez les notions avancées de l'administration d'une base de données PostgreSQL comme la configuration fine d'une instance pour de meilleures performances, la gestion efficace des connexions et l'utilisation des scripts pour faciliter l'exploitation.

Objectifs pédagogiques

  • Comprendre les outils de mesure et diagnostic du SGBD PostgreSQL
  • Maîtriser les techniques d'optimisation des applications
  • Analyser et optimiser les performances du serveur et des applications
  • Optimiser le schéma relationnel et les requêtes SQL
PROGRAMME DE FORMATION

Présentation de PostgreSQL

  • Rappels succincts sur l'administration de PostgreSQL.

Création et administration d'une instance

  • Les répertoires de données. Les logs de transactions et d'activités.
  • Installation des tâches automatiques. Gestion des volumes.
  • Utilisation des espaces de stockage.
  • Définition de l'espace des logs de transactions. Chargement de données avec pgLoader.
  • Partitionnement de tables. Vues matérialisées.
  • Administration d'une instance. Utilisation du catalogue système.
  • Suivi des volumes. Suivi des connexions.
  • Suivi des transactions.

Contributions pour l'administrateur

  • pg_stattuple : état des tables et des index.
  • pg_freespacemap : état des espaces libres.
  • pg_buffercache : état de la mémoire.

Evaluation des performances et création d'instances multiples

  • Evaluation des performances : test d'une instance avec pgbench.
  • Création d'instances multiples.
  • Ressources utiles.
  • Adaptation des configurations.

Performances et réglages (rappels)

  • Limiter les connexions.
  • Dimensionnement de la mémoire partagée.
  • Opérations de tri et de hachage.
  • Optimiser les suppressions de données.
  • Optimiser la gestion du journal de transactions.
  • Affiner l'auto-vacuum avec les seuils.

Supervision d'une instance

  • PgFouine. Analyse des logs d'activités et des messages de Vacuum.
  • Munin. Mise en place des scripts PostgreSQL.
  • Création d'un script.

Gestion avancée des connexions

  • PgPool-II. Installation et configuration du gestionnaire de pool.
  • Les cas d'utilisation.
  • Définitions des pools de connexions.
  • PgPoolAdmin. Installation de l'interface d'administration.
  • Configuration du gestionnaire.

Compléments (vision globale)

  • Définition de la réplication et de la haute disponibilité.
  • Présentation de Warm Standby.
  • Présentation de Slony.
Participants / Prerequisite

» Participants

Administrateurs de bases de données et administrateurs des systèmes.

» Prerequisite

Bonnes connaissances en administration PostgreSQL ou connaissances équivalentes à celles apportées par le stage PostgreSQL, administration (réf. PGA).
Intra/Tailored

Contact Informations

By checking this box, I certify that I have read and accepted the conditions for the use of my data regarding the General Data Protection Regulation (GDPR).
You can at any time modify the use of your data and exercise your rights by sending an email to rgpd@orsys.fr
By checking this box, I agree to receive commercial and promotional communications from ORSYS Training*. You can unsubscribe at any time by using the link included in our communications.

Book your place

Click on a session for reserving.

Time schedule

Generally, courses take place from 9:00 to 12:30 and from 14:00 to 17:30.
However, on the first day attendees are welcomed from 8:45, and there is a presentation of the session between 9:15 and 9:30.
The course itself begins at 9:30. For the 4- or 5-day hands-on courses, the sessions finish at 15:30 on the last day
linkedin orsys
twitter orsys
it! orsys
instagram orsys
pinterest orsys
facebook orsys
youtube orsys
LA LETTRE DE
LA TRANSFORMATION DIGITALE
Recevez la newsletter